drm/i915/gvt: add a NULL pointer check to avoid kernel panic



Due to the request replay, context switch interrupt may come after
gvt free the workload thus can cause a kernel NULL pointer kernel
panic. This patch will add a simple check to avoid this for a short
term.

From long term, gvt workload lifecycle doesn't match with i915 request
and need to find a proper way to manage this.

v4: simplify the NULL pointer check.
v5: add unlikely to optimize.
